经常关注 GMTC 全球大前端技术大会的同学应该会发现,今年的 GMTC 没有单独策划 Flutter 和小程序相关的专题了,跟跨端这一主题相关的,只保留了一个跨端技术专题,关注 React Native 新架构的落地,也关注 Kotlin、WebAssembly 如何在跨端中发挥作用,以及其他跨端的新思路。
看到这里,你也许会有几个问题想要问我们。
第一个问题,为什么没有 Flutter、小程序了?是它们不火了吗?不,是它们暂时没有大的更新了。
Google 近期的动作,大多是对之前的 Flutter 生态做补齐,比如 Flutter for Web。此外,包大小也导致了 Fultter 在很多超级 App 上落地艰难,它需要找到更适合的场景。
那小程序专题为什么也消失了?与 Flutter 相似,小程序的发展也进入了一个平台期,大家的方案大同小异,从听众的收益来看,我们决定暂时不专门划分一个分会场来讨论它了。
第二个问题,为什么是 Kotlin、WebAssembly?
Kotlin 语言不仅可以应用于 Android 端,还可以通过 Kotlin Multiplatform 支持服务端、移动端的应用及中间件开发,同时呢,通过 Kotlin 到 JavaScript 的转换和互操作,你还可以使用 Kotlin 开发 Web 应用。具备现代、简洁和安全等特点的 Kotlin 语言,自然成为了未来跨平台研发模式的一种新选择,我们十分看好这门语言的发展。
WebAssembly 性能好,分发能力强,前端对它的呼声日渐高涨。所以,我们想看看,你们前端天天喊 WebAssembly,实际到底做得怎么样了。
以上就是今年的 GMTC 北京站对于「跨端技术」专题的思考,我们邀请了字节跳动 Flutter Infra 团队负责人董岩担任出品人,为专题质量把关。他在跨端领域有多年实践经验,去年的 GMTC 北京站上,也贡献过高质量演讲。
目前专题已确认两个议题,分别是 Weex2.0(是的,你没看错,Weex 今年将推出 2.0 版本,这一版本他们内部打磨了很久,是真的带着诚意来的),和来自腾讯 PCG 的 DSL 跨平台动态化方案(探讨差异化的应用,在不同场景下如何解决不同的问题)。
本次大会中,还有低代码、大前端 DevOps、前端框架新体验、大前端监控、移动端性能与效率优化等专题。同时,我们也关注大前端破圈的有效姿势,首次聚焦 B 端研发效能、IoT 动态应用开发、TypeScript、云研发实践、大前端技术融合与跨界等,并邀请 winter 等大咖前来参与“师兄帮帮忙”晚场交流活动,与你讨论“前端如何有效增值”的话题。
了解更多软件开发与相关领域知识,点击访问 InfoQ 官网:https://www.infoq.cn/,获取更多精彩内容!